JIS College of Engineering accepts the following entrance exam scores for admission to BTech:
1- WB-JEE (West Bengal Joint Entrance Examination)
2- JEE Main (Joint Entrance Examination Main)
3- CEE AMPAI (Common Entrance Examination AMPAI)
Candidates who meet the minimum eligibility criteria set by JIS College of Engineering with a valid score in any of the above entrance exams can apply for admission to the BTech program. The admission process is conducted through the West Bengal Joint Entrance Examination (WBJEE) or Joint Entrance Examination (JEE Main) or Association of Minority Professional Academic Institutes (AMPAI). JIS College of Engineering Placements: 

JIS College of Engineering has a good placement record, with almost 85-90% of students getting placed every year. According to the JIS College of Engineering NIRF report 2023, the placement rate recorded during JIS College of Engineering M.Tech placements 2022 was 86%. The highest package offered at JIS College of Engineering is 12 LPA (lakhs per annum). The eligibility criteria for BTech at JIS College of Engineering are as follows:
1- Candidates must have passed Higher Secondary (10+2) Examination of West Bengal Council of Higher Secondary Education or equivalent examination from a recognised board with Physics, Chemistry, and Mathematics as compulsory subjects.
2- Candidates must secure a minimum of 45% marks in 10+2 in PCM.
3- Candidates must be at least 17 years of age. There is no upper age limit.
4- Candidates must qualify for either WB-JEE or JEE Main or AMPAI.

Yes, JIS College of Engineering accepts Joint Entrance Examination for Bachelor of Technology admission. In addition to Joint Entrance Examination, students can also qualify for admission with a valid score in WB-JEE or CEE AMPAI exams. To be eligible for admission, students must secure 45 percent in 10+2 in Physics, Chemistry, and Mathematics. The merit list is prepared by MAKAUT for admission to the Bachelor of Technology program.

The college has a total of 627 admitted students, 682 graduated students, and 585 placed students.

The intake capacity for each branch of BTech program offered by the college is as follows:
Computer Science and Engineering: 120
Electronics and Communication Engineering: 120
Electrical Engineering: 60
Mechanical Engineering: 60
Civil Engineering: 60

JIS College of Engineering has a decent placement record for BTech students. Here are some key points:

  • The placement rate recorded during JIS College of Engineering BTech and M.Tech placements 2022 was 86%. 
  • Almost 85% of students got placed in the B.Tech course. The average salary package offered is 4.5 LPA.
  • JIS College of Engineering, Kolkata placement programme provides for employment opportunities to the students with an equal emphasis on IT and Core engineering.

JIS College of Engineering is a private college recognised by the University Grants Commission (UGC) . It was established in 2000 and is located in Kalyani, West Bengal, India. The college was declared autonomous by the UGC in 2011 and is affiliated with Maulana Abul Kalam Azad University of Technology, West Bengal (MAKAUT, WB) . JIS College of Engineering is accredited by the National Assessment and Accreditation Council (NAAC) with Grade-A. It is also approved by the All India Council for Technical Education (AICTE) and the National Board of Accreditation (NBA).
